"shippen" meaning in English

See shippen in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

Forms: shippens [plural]
Etymology: From Middle English schipne, schepne, schüpene, from Old English scypen (“cow-shed, stall, shippen”), from Proto-Germanic *skupīnō (“stall”), diminutive of *skup- (“shed, barn”). Related to shop, shepen.
